Can low voltage damage fan?

Just as higher voltages can help reduce motor operating temperatures, low voltage is a major cause of motor overheating and premature failure. A low voltage forces a motor to draw extra current to deliver the power expected of it thus overheating the motor windings.

Does stabilizer consume electricity when AC is off?

AC stabiliser consists of windings and relays for protection purpose. When we turn off the AC but kep the stabiliser on, it hardly consumes any power (as compared to the loads). The stabiliser consumes only 1-2 watt/hr of power when turned on which is very low.

Do we need stabilizer?

Most modern refrigerators are designed to handle large voltage range. It is important to check the power specifications of your refrigerator before you buy a stabilizer for it. If the operating voltage range is large, then you do not need a stabilizer for it. But if it is less, then you do need a stabilizer.

Is water softener required for washing machine?

Yes,certainly. Generally any water having TDS(total dissolved solid) is more than 500ppm and total hardness more then 65 ppm is termed hard water,which may not give enough lather with soap. Hence for washing purposes you need water softener. For drinking purposes you can R.O by keeping TDS around 150–200 ppm.

How do I choose a voltage stabilizer?

Here are few simple tips to select a stabilizer: To get the maximum power - Multiply "230 x Max rated Current" of all the equipment that are to be connected to the stabilizer. Add a 20-25% safety margin to arrive at stabilizer rating. If you have plans to add more devices later, you can keep buffer for them.

Is voltage stabilizer required for inverter AC?

For inverter ACs, all the components are designed to work in those conditions. Usually the range is 160 to 245 V. So if your voltage does not fall beyond this range, then no stabilizer is required.
